Everything needed to pass the first part of the City & Guilds
2365 Diploma in Electrical Installations. Basic Electrical
Installation Work will be of value to students taking the first
year course of an electrical installation apprenticeship, as well
as lecturers teaching it. The book provides answers to all of the
2365 syllabus learning outcomes, and one chapter is dedicated to
each of the five units in the City & Guilds course. This
edition is brought up to date and in line with the 18th Edition of
the IET Regulations: It can be used to support independent learning
or a college based course of study Full-colour diagrams and
photographs explain difficult concepts and clear definitions of
technical terms make the book a quick and easy reference Extensive
online material on the companion website
www.routledge.com/cw/linsley helps both students and lecturers
